What is WFUZZ?

•  It ́s a web application brute forcer, that allows you to perform complex brute force attacks in different web application parts as: parameters, authentication, forms, directories/files, headers files, etc.

•  It has complete set of features, payloads and encodings.

A brute force attack is a method to determine an unknown value by using an automated process to try a large number of possible values.

Why 2010 still bruteforcing?

"   In 2007 Gunter Ollmann proposed a series of countermeasures to stop automated attack tools.!

Page 15: Wfuzz for Penetration Testers

Countermeasures

"   Block HEAD requests!

"   Timeouts and thresholds!

"   Referer checks!

"   Tokens !

Page 16: Wfuzz for Penetration Testers

Countermeasures

"   Turing tests (captchas)!

"   Honeypot links !

"   One time links!

"   Custom messages!

"   Token resource metering (Hashcash)!

Bypass??

Page 19: Wfuzz for Penetration Testers

How?

"   Distributing scanning source traffic

"   Distributing scanning in target (differents subdomains,servers)

"   Diagonal scanning (different username/password each round)

"   Horizontal scanning (different usernames for common passwords)

Page 20: Wfuzz for Penetration Testers

How?

"   Three dimension ( Horizontal,Vertical or Diagonal + Distributing source IP)

"   Four dimensions ( Horizontal, Vertical or Diagonal + time delay)
